1. Conduct a detailed inspection.
Whether you're selling a camping tent in a brick-and-mortar store or online, it's essential that you perform a comprehensive evaluation of the equipment to ensure that everything is as expected. This will help you establish a practical rate and stay clear of any shocks for possible buyers.
Start by meticulously reviewing the outdoor tents's setting up directions and inspecting that all parts are included. If the tent has adjustable features, test them to ensure that they work as advertised.
Also, examine that the tent is free from any kind of concerns like an opening in the roofing or an abrasion in the textile. Any type of such defects could significantly affect resale value.
2. Clean the outdoor tents.
Outdoors tents collect a layer of dirt that stains them and makes them odoriferous. It is very important to extensively clean up a tent before placing it in storage, as packing a wet one is an invitation for mildew.
Collect your cleaning supplies, consisting of a bathtub, water, soap and gear cleaner. Submerge the outdoor tents and fluster it with a nonabrasive sponge or fabric to remove as much dust as possible.
You might additionally take this chance to refresh the waterproof layers and finishes. This will make sure the tent maintains rain out along with it did when you bought it. Be sincere about your outdoor tents's problem when you list it on the internet-- buyers value openness.
